Attorney-at-law in the Transaction and Contract Counselling Team. She specialises in commercial and corporate law, compliance, and contract law. She provides day-to-day advice to entities with German and Swiss capital, including in particular drafting and negotiating contracts, such as complex contracts on distribution, supplies, and implementation of technological lines. She supports clients in the contract performance, also in crisis situations where a party does not perform a contract or performs it improperly. Her clients include international production and retail chains. She also has experience in helping foreign investors enter the Polish market, including obtaining permits for operating in Special Economic Zones. Her advice is focused on the client’s business needs and ensuring the highest level of legal security. She successfully represents clients in disputes regarding the contract performance.


Selected projects

  • participation in a project involving establishment of a company with Swiss capital, operating in the area of fastening technologies for the automotive industry, in a Special Economic Zone, including preparation and submission of an offer, carrying out of a legal due diligence of the property to be acquired, and provision of legal assistance with purchasing a property, participation in negotiations with the Zone, drafting of an agreement on hall construction based on the FIDIC standards, and participation in the negotiations with a general contractor; value of the transaction: PLN 22 million;
  • participation in purchasing an organised part of an enterprise (including movables in the form of sanitary appliances, rights and obligations under commercial contracts with customers and employment contracts) by a company with German capital; representation of a purchaser in the negotiations;
  • carrying out of a legal due diligence of an enterprise – a company operating in the sector of cullet sale and waste glass collection;
  • representation of an employer in court proceedings regarding Social Insurance Institution’s (ZUS) refusal to issue certificates on declaring Polish law the applicable law for social insurance (A1); obtaining favourable judgments for the client before the Appellate Court obliging ZUS to issue such certificates.
